Answer:
60°
please look into the solution down here.
Step-by-step explanation:
since BD bisects it, then the angles should be bisected symmetrically, or in other words, ANGLE ABD = angle DBC,
hence,
4x = 2x +30
2x = 30
x = 15
therefore, angle DBC = 2x + 30 = 2(15) + 30 = 60°.

Answer:each album costs $7 and you buy x of them
cost of albums = 7x
each movie costs $8 and you have you have y of them
cost of movies = 8y
total cost is has to be less than $47
---> 7x + 8y < 47
sketch the graph of 7x + 8y = 47 , a straight line, and shade in the region below that line. Of course you would stay in the first quadrant, (x > 0, and y >0 , since you can't have negative number of movies and albums)
Since you can't buy partial albums and movies, both x and y have to be whole numbers.
So for solutions you would consider only ordered pairs that have whole numbers as their components.
e.g. (2, 2) or (1,5)
